Yes, Pirate, I agree with many of Rich's comments as well. What I was also saying is that the cannabis grown for hemp fibre is very low in THC, and knowledgable tokers would not waste their time on industrial grade hemp. There is a lot of hemp grown in Germany, Switzerland and Japan. Japan has over 4,000 hectares planted in hemp, a lot of which is about 50 km north of Tokyo, in one prefecture that is licenced to grow. It is becoming more noticeable in some countries, and it certainly is possible to obtain licences to grow hemp where the proper laws are in place. Maybe some day we will learn how to cope with drugs and drug laws in the U.S. and Canada, but I wouldn't count on it in the near future. We are simply the most medicated society on the face of the earth.
